News Summary: Tesla introduces crucial new car

TESLA’S BIG TEST: Tesla Motors will start selling its all-electric Model S sedan Friday. It’s a make-or-break car for the company, which is aiming for a mainstream customer. Tesla’s only previous model was a high-end sports car.

THE DETAILS: The Model S is a five-seat sedan that can go up to 300 miles on an electric charge. It has no backup gas engine.

WILL IT SELL?: Tesla says it expects to sell 5,000 Model S sedans worldwide this year and 20,000 next year. But some analysts say its price tag — starting at $49,900 — will limit sales.
